題 名 | 糖對蓮霧果皮花青素生合成的影響=Effects of Sugars on Anyhocyanin Biosysnthesis in Wax Apple Fruit Skin |

中文摘要 | 為探討蓮霧果皮花青素的生合成的影響因子,本試驗利用果皮離體培養技術,探 討不同種類與濃度的糖處理對蓮霧果實著色的影響,供作進一步研究蓮霧果皮花青素生合成 機制的基礎及田間實際栽培管理應用的依據。依試驗的結果得知,不論在幼果或成熟果的綠 色果皮培養,糖類(果糖、葡萄糖、麥芽糖及蔗糖)添加均可以增加花青素的含量,並隨著 添加的濃度增加而增加, 其中又以蔗糖的添加有最好的效果。 各糖類與皮花青素間均有 0.1% 水準極顯著的正相關,且相關係係數均高達 0.92 以上。 在葉綠素方面,幼果期的果 皮在加糖的處理中其葉綠素的含量均較不加糖的對照組低,成熟期的葉綠素差異則較小。 。 |
英文摘要 | The color of fruit, being one of the most important criteria for fruit quality, is found to associate closely with the popularity and price in the market in wax apples in Taiwan. As skin color reflects the presence of anthocyanin, an in vivo tissue-culture experiment was conducted to elucidate the existing relationship between the two and the potential influence of the added sugar on the anthocyanin content. Isolated skins at two developmental stages of the fruit were incubated on the liquid media containing different concentrations of sugar under a controlled environment. Results indicated the additions of sugar (fructose, glucose, maltose or sucrose) decreased the chlorophyll content and induced the synthesis of anthocyanin in the peel of either young or mature wax apple fruits. The degrees of enhancement were positively correlated with sugar concentrations. Sucrose was the most effective one among the four kinds of sugar tested. |
